iCOM is a cross-platform component architecture, merging the best features of CORBA with COM style binary components. This release fixes some major bugs and simplifies the build process. iCOM has a modern C++ language mapping. Which is designed to be standard conforming, and uses exception handling. Also included is a Python language mapping, which allows both the creation and use of components. Both language mappings support most of the advanced features of CORBA including sequences, structures, unions, typecodes, and anys. Currently, UNIX varieties and win32 are supported on x86.
